Kick Off Fundraiser for AIDS Memorial in San Diego Brings Iconic
LGBT Talent to San Diego
AIDS Memorials have been established in major
cities around the world and it’s long overdue for San Diego to join those
ranks. With nearly 8,000 deaths to-date related to HIV/AIDS in San Diego
County, it is imperative that San Diegans remember those that have passed and
continue to fight until there is a cure. The AIDS Memorial will be a place of
remembrance and reflection. The AIDS Memorial Task Force is co-chaired by San
Diego Mayor Kevin Falconer’s wife, Katherine Stuart, and LGBT activist, Nicole
Murray-Ramirez. This project will be funded with private contributions.
Essential responsibilities of the task force will include “Call for Design”
efforts, location determination, fundraising efforts and finally an unveiling
ceremony when the memorial comes to fruition.
The Task Force is excited to announce that fundraising for the memorial will kick off with an AIDS Memorial “Concert for Life” on March 26th, 2015, produced by Being Alive SD, and Susan Jester.
